Output 38c90dc6e25b530823619fa2b60138b6cf2333a1cef02ce73ee27ea76bc58f0b:0

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8340110e6b5ec494550d9c326eb0dd22314a2d4f OP_EQUAL
address
3Df1C6oFHToZswjXvMoQifKNNAApFhJpzb
transaction
38c90dc6e25b530823619fa2b60138b6cf2333a1cef02ce73ee27ea76bc58f0b
spent
true